Reclaimed Oak – Character in Its Most Authentic Form
Our reclaimed oak planks embody natural beauty, individuality, and a particularly sustainable approach to the valuable raw material that is wood. Each plank tells its own story and captivates with its varying lengths and widths, an expressive textured appearance, and the unmistakable character of genuine reclaimed wood. The natural surface is carefully brought out and deliberately preserved to retain its original appearance. Knots, natural grain patterns, and unique color nuances make each plank one-of-a-kind. The naturally oiled surface gives the wood a pleasantly warm feel while providing durable protection that highlights the natural beauty of the oak.
Particularly sustainable: The wear layer of our reclaimed wood planks is sourced from existing reclaimed wood—including old beams and materials salvaged from the demolition of abandoned houses and barns. This valuable, sustainable raw material is processed and transformed into a high-quality, durable floor. In this way, the existing wood is given a second life and becomes a premium material for sophisticated interiors.
This is how we combine resource conservation with timeless aesthetics—in the spirit of conscious and sustainable living. The combination of varying lengths and widths, a vibrant texture, and a natural oil finish gives the floor an authentic, handcrafted look. Reclaimed oak—sustainable, full of character, and unique.
Upon request, we can also produce our reclaimed wood planks in reclaimed larch or spruce.

What Else You Should Know About Villa by adler Reclaimed Oak
surface treatment is based on our NATURA+ oiled oxidatively oiled surface treatment on a machine brushed wood structure. This means that the “soft years" are brushed out and you therefore are left with the “hard years".
For private use of your parquet your wooden flooring is ready for you to move in immediately after it has been installed. If the wooden floor is to be subjected to further stress, which is principally the case, when the rooms are used for commercial purposes, we recommend a finishing treatment after installation. Wood is a natural product. Differences in the substances in the wood and the wood grain can lead to colour deviations in colour treated surfaces. These differences in colour can also occur between different product batches, as well as within a single product batch. This applies in particular to coloured surfaces, since the application of colour pigments can cause variations in shades because of the structure of the wood. However, this is a mark of authenticity for wood as a natural product.
This product can be installed both in a floating version and by full glue spreading on your floor screed.
Our Villa by adler Reclaimed Oak country house plank is also approved for installation on a hot water based underfloor heating system. Its thermal resistance is approx. 0.122 m²k / W (pursuant to EN14342). If you want to install the Villa by Adler Reclaimed Oak wooden plank on an underfloor heating system, we always recommend installation with total glue down on your floor screed. A maximum temperature of the subfloor of 23°C – 28°C should not be exceeded. So that you have a lot of enjoyment of your multi-layer parquet, you must give it the appropriate care.
You should also ensure that you have a healthy indoor climate, not just for your parquet, which consists of wood, a living natural substance, but also for yourself. This means a relative air humidity of approx. 40 – 60% and a pleasant room temperature of 19 – 22°C.
If the air humidity and temperature drop below these reference values, this may cause great harm to your wooden floor.
